"You're doing it all wrong. Look at me."

Gu Hai stood up and facing the magnificent sea that surged forth against the delicate sands, he shouted loudly.

"My name is Gu Hai, male, 18 years old, from Beijing. The person sitting down beside me is my wife. Two days ago, last year, we fell in love with each other and made it official. It's been a year already since our journey together started! Despite the ups and downs and the constant disasters thrown at us, we will not surrender or hesitate to advance bravely."[1]

To his side, Bai Luo Yin watched as the plumes of Gu Hai's breath billowed out and quickly dissipated into the air. The voice was unexpected. It was loud, with an agreeable trace of huskiness and a hint of more power than the once frail body could produce. Hearing it in such close proximity to him, Bai Luo Yin wanted to bury his entire being into the sand.

After divulging this supposed secret, a sense of relief also tugged at Gu Hai's mind. A small smile drew back the corner of his lips as he looks down at Bai Luo Yin with provocation. "Do you dare?"

The underlying meaning to those three words were, 'are you as bold as I am?'

"Why wouldn't I dare to?" Bai Luo Yin also stood up and shouted loudly, "My name is Bai Luo Yin, male, 18 years old. My family lives in Beijing, Xicheng district on the most brilliant Lane 48. I am a third-year student studying at Beijing X High School, Class 27, who's also a rather bad youth. Standing beside me is my wife. After enduring his shameless harassment, out of compassion for his mental state, I took pity and decided to marry him into my family. Since my father-in-law does not agree to us being together, this marriage has yet to be settled. But, I am wholeheartedly devoted to my wife's love. Regardless of whether he will continue to have this mental illness or not, I will never betray or leave him in this lifetime!"

Gu Hai immediately started to laugh. The laugh was not only in his voice, but it also welled in his eyes, in the way his face changed into that vision of relaxed joy and unrestrained mirth. Yet, truly, it wasn't only in his face either. His laugh came from within the core of his being.

You little bastard, you got me.

Never one to back down from a challenge, Gu Hai went on to shout, "Gu Wei Ting, I'm telling you, even if you send a whole army troop with thousands of men to hunt us down, I will still say those same words from before. If I firmly believe in someone, no one can even think of changing it! If I firmly believe in a relationship, no one can even think of tearing it apart! If I firmly believe in these feelings, no one can even think of destroying them!"

"Gu Wei Ting!……" Bai Luo Yin shouted those words but then he halted.

Raising his head, Gu Hai turned to look at him with great expectations.

"I fucked your son!"

Gu Hai ground his teeth as his big hand quickly reached out to pinch the back of Bai Luo Yin's neck. Bai Luo Yin burst into a spell of smiles before laughter rang out from within his throat. The laugh came from him like a newly blossomed flower - timid at first then it grew a bit at a time. Gu Hai watched him attentively. The other boy wasn't done yet though. He could tell, from the way Bai Luo Yin rolled his eyes back to the sky and half bit his lips. It was all too apparent, from deep inside his chest came a great shaking motion that caused his facial muscles to grow tight. Gu Hai's brows rose, waiting.

In moments, Bai Luo Yin's laugh was more like fully blossomed flower petals being thrown into the brilliant sky then falling around on everyone nearby with unrestrained gales that debilitated him to a stomach-gripping breathless picture of glee. Gu Hai wanted to maintain the sternness sheathing from his face—since after all he was the one being laughed at—but before long, his mouth twitched upwards and he too fell into a spell of laughter.

"All these setbacks will not wear down our fighting spirit!"

"No difficulties will stop our footsteps!"

"We've joined together to oppose a common enemy!"

"We will never waver!"

The two shouted until all the oxygen in their lungs was nearly depleted.

All the people nearby practically walked away from them, leaving behind only a man who stayed firmly in his spot. The two simultaneously moved their gazes toward him.

The man merely looked at them and laughed inarticulately, "You two are really stupid!"

As a result, the two stupidly cute boys took this man and threw him into the sea.

Gu Hai took out a video camera that he had turned on before and showed Bai Luo Yin the video playback of what happened a moment ago.

"You actually recorded it?"

Gu Hai looked at him happily while saying, "Of course! This kind of mutual understanding is rare."

Bai Luo Yin stretched his head over for a look. The silhouettes of the two people on the screen were painted with exuberant youth and liveliness.

"Say, when we look at this a few years from now, will we be terrified by ourselves?"

"We won't."

Gu Hai placed his hand firmly on Bai Luo Yin's shoulder, "It's rare to have a chance to be silly in life. To not be silly or make a mistake means to not have lived a youthful life."

The sea water rose, and the few tourists that were scattered around started to depart the area. Afterwards, Bai Luo Yin and Gu Hai found a restaurant and ate a great meal comprising of the most delicious seafood. On their way back, they bought a tent and two bed comforters to set up. They intended to spend the night on the beach so that they can watch the sunrise at dawn of the next day.

In the evening, as usual, Bai Luo Yin gave Bai Han Qi a phone call, briefing him on their current situation as well as inquiring about any new circumstances at home.

"Gu Hai's father hasn't gone over to look for you yet?" Bai Luo Yin asked.

Gu Hai also moved in closer to listen.

"No, he hasn't. It has been unusually calm for the last two days. No one has come at all."

Bai Luo Yin did not feel at ease, "You're lying to me, aren't you?"

"Why would I lie to you? Listen here, it's really calm and peaceful in the house right now," replied Bai Han Qi.

Hearing those words, Bai Luo Yin was extremely puzzled.

According to logic, it shouldn't be like that!

After putting the phone down, Bai Luo Yin faced Gu Hai and asked, "Do you think my dad is telling us the truth?"

"From the sound of it, it doesn't seem like a lie."

Bai Luo Yin's brows pulled close to each other forming a frown as he thought to himself.

What is Gu Wei Ting planning to do?

"That's enough. Don't think about it so hard. Let's worry about it when it happens. Look, the sea breeze is really gentle tonight and the moon hanging high in the sky is quite luminous against the darkness. With such a beautiful scenery like this, there is no need for my wife to go and think about those troublesome matters. It is better to accompany your husband by being very romantic for a while."

Hearing those nauseating words, Bai Luo Yin simply grabbed Gu Hai's head and pressed it into the sand.

In the early morning of the next day, the sky was still painted in a canvas of darkness when Bai Luo Yin awoke with errant excitement.

After he finished putting on his clothes, he grabbed the camera and made his way out of the tent with a small smile tugging the corners of his lips.

Meanwhile, Gu Hai slept very vigilantly. The moment he became aware that the space beside him was cold and empty, his eyes immediately shot open bringing him out of his slumber.

At this time of the day, dusk was slowly waning in the open sky and their surroundings were filled with cold fog. Gu Hai stepped on the soft sand and walked towards Bai Luo Yin one step at a time. Once close enough, he reached out and encircled his hands around Bai Luo Yin's waist from the back. He tightened his hold just a bit, making sure the loving warmth from his body spread before he rested his chin on Bai Luo Yin's shoulder.

"The sky is still dark…" Gu Hai's lethargic voice drifted into Bai Luo Yin's ears, tickling it.

"Who waits until daybreak to see the sunrise?"

Nuzzling closer, Gu Hai's lips were now glued to Bai Luo Yin's warm cheek. He rubbed against it for the longest time, feeling the soft and familiar skin.

"Quick, look!" Bai Luo Yin exclaimed as he pointed towards the vastness that spread in front of them.

Gu Hai lifted his head and looked up. A streak of rosy red clouds emerged in the distance just above Bai Luo Yin's finger. It slowly changed to a deeper shade as it dispersed across the horizon, creating a colorful glow in the sky. Soon, the sun rose halfway, causing the surrounding clouds to be engulfed in an array of scarlet hues. The sunlight gradually became brighter, blending the sky and the sea into one beautiful scenery meant only for them to view. A pleasant feeling of warmth draped their bodies to the point that their bones became soft and ridden with happiness……

"Come, let's take a picture."

Gu Hai lifted the camera and placed it in front of their faces.

With their backs facing the sea and their heads resting upon the sunrise, they snuggled their faces close to each other. As they looked at the camera lens, mischievous smiles bloomed on their faces, exposing a secret, mutual understanding that only existed between them.

Once the photo was taken, they looked at it with curious eyes. Within seconds, Bai Luo Yin laughed joyfully as he glanced at Gu Hai.

"Why does it feel like a buddhist ceremony?"

"Have you ever seen such a handsome buddhist monk before?" Gu Hai proudly praised himself, "Later on, I'll use it as my laptop's wallpaper."

It was from this day on that Gu Hai's photo album had one more picture of his exuberant smile.

Not far from where Bai Luo Yin and Gu Hai were, was a pair of lovers being photographed in their wedding outfits. The bride had on a glamorous wedding dress as she stood atop a large reef posing in various postures while the groom shifted back and forth beside her. Just right below where they were standing, a photographer and a consultant touched base. They talked–their voices were inaudible–while moving their hands in all sorts of positions.

After watching them for a moment, Gu Hai thought of something and spoke.

"That woman looks really ugly. If she wasn't wearing any makeup, what would she look like?!"

Glancing at Gu Hai, a seemingly annoyed Bai Luo Yin gave him a shove, "Why do you care what other people look like?!"

Seconds later, the two walked side by side towards their own tent.

Just as they finished tidying up their belongings and prepared to leave, they suddenly heard shouts reverberating not too far from where they were. Curious, their eyes followed the source of the commotion. They discovered a crowd of people swarming the area where the couple were previously having their wedding photoshoot. Judging from the sounds, it looked like an incident has occurred.

"Come on, let's take a look," said Bai Luo Yin.

Giving each other a quick glance, the two placed their belongings down and sprinted towards the disturbance.

As they approached the area, they came to realize that the bride had fallen into the sea. Gauging from the photoshoot earlier, it was most likely due to her excessive posturing and carelessness that caused her to fall from the reef.

Normally jumping in to rescue someone was not a difficult task but the crucial point was, it was winter then. Who would actually dare to heedlessly jump into the cold water? Moreover, the bride was wearing a wedding dress that seemed to weigh more than ten kilograms. Even worse, once submerged, the wedding dress soaked up the seawater and became even heavier. When the bride had just fallen into the sea, two men began to pull her gown in an attempt to save her. But due to the increase in weight, they were nearly dragged into the water as well. Ridden with apprehension and seeing no other options, they gave up.

In no time, the groom was driven crazy with anxiety as he watched his bride sink deeper into the sea. He stood on the same spot at the top of the reef and let out a heart wrenching howl. He completely had no idea of what to do! Unfortunately, at this time of the day, the lifeguards had yet to wake up. From the looks of it, by the time they arrive on the scene, the bride would have been dead already.

Unable to look on, Gu Hai took off his watch and cellphone and pressed it against Bai Luo Yin's chest for him to hold onto.

"Wait for me right here!"

Bai Luo Yin's eyes widened slightly as fear visibly drew across his face, "You want to go down?"

Without answering, Gu Hai quickened his pace and made way towards the seashore. Just as he tore of his shoes and jacket and prepared to jump into the water, Bai Luo Yin pulled his hand back at full tilt. He then asked with a hint of worry tracing his voice, "Are you sure that it's safe?"

Instead of saying anything else again, Gu Hai jumped directly from the reef into the ocean beneath.

In such cold weather, Gu Hai had jumped directly into the sea without having done any prior warmups. The group of bystanders were terribly shocked as they watched this event unfold. They thought silently to themselves.

Does this young man not want to live anymore? There's no need to go to such lengths to save someone! Is he just asking for a death wish?!

Complying to Gu Hai's words, Bai Luo Yin stood waiting. His eyes lingered on Gu Hai's form from the moment he jumped to when his body entered the water. Although he was unable to see them, he could feel beads of sweat forming on his forehead that were rolling down the side of his face. His chest tightened, making way for a nameless feeling to wring his heart.

If something were to really happen, he would also follow after him and jump in. Everything else can just be as it is.

Meanwhile, Gu Hai swam while dredging about the water. At this point, the bride had already sank deeper. Concentrating, Gu Hai swam further out a few more meters. Suddenly, he sensed something unnatural in the current and plunged deeper into the sea.

All the bystanders ashore inhaled a deep breath of cold air as they looked on. The photographer muttered to himself, almost incoherent. "That young man is very kind. It's sad that he died like that."

Hearing those words, Bai Luis Yin’s complexion immediately turned a pasty white. He quickly climbed onto the highest section of that reef and looked out, with focus, at the surface of the water. His eyes, barely blinking, scanned the area from one vast corner to the next. Ridden with worry and anxiety, he felt like his heart was about to jump out of his throat.

Gu Hai, you must come out!

"Young man, you shouldn't be depressed and take things too hard!"

A couple of seconds later, Bai Luo Yin was pulled down from the reef by a foolish man, who continuously plead with him at the top of his lungs.

"Young man, I failed to stop him from doing such a stupid and dangerous thing because I didn't have the time. Don't you dare follow him and imitate such a disastrous move! Having the heart to save someone is a great thing, but you also need to act according to your capabilities. I'm only able to tell you this, restrain your grief. He is a good person!"

"That's impossible! He will not die!!"

Bai Luo Yin bellowed out in anger as he resentfully shook off the person holding him.

Just as he flung the person's hands away, Bai Luo Yin heard an exclamation crying in surprise from the side.

"He's out. He's actually coming out!"

Scrambling, Bai Luo Yin hastily ran over to the spot that Gu Hai emerged from.

At first, Gu Hai wanted to pull the bride along with her wedding dress to the shore. However, he realized that carrying both was too heavy of a burden for him. In the end, he dove deeper under the water, grabbed the dress and forcefully tore it apart. After he managed to free the bride from the tangles of her leaden garment, he proceeded to support her as he swam towards the shoreline.

Once they were ashore, the lifeguards also rushed over to assist one by one. The bride was lifted onto a stretcher and quickly given CPR. A moment later, she regained consciousness and cried out that it was cold. Hearing her, the emergency personnel quickly covered her with a thick blanket. Soon, the bride's emotional tears fell from her eyes.

Once Gu Hai caught sight of this scene, his heart was instantly relieved. In the end, all his efforts were not in vain.

Bai Luo Yin immediately wrapped the jacket, that Gu Hai had previously taken off, around him while urging him to change out of his cold and wet clothes.

Out of nowhere, a swarm of reporters rushed over. As soon as they got out of the car, they bee-lined over to the site of the incident.

As the news people questioned him, the groom pointed towards Gu Hai. It was evident that he was emotionally moved as he spoke to them. "It's that young man. He's the one that jumped into the water and saved my girlfriend!"

As a result, several reporters turned toward Bai Luo Yin and Gu Hai and ran over towards them as if trying to chase them down. The two had just set up their tent again and were about to change their clothes when suddenly they were surrounded by a throng of reporters and cameramen.

"Hello, I heard that you saved a person just now. Excuse me, may I ask, are you a local person? What is your name?"

The moment Gu Hai and Bai Luo Yin noticed the video cameras, their complexions changed.

Without saying anything, they exchanged a quick glance, took one huge step backward and jetted off into the distance. With the reporters wildly in pursuit, Gu Hai and Bai Luo Yin didn't bother to take their belongings or change out of their clothes. It was in this manner that they escaped without looking back.

Unable to run any longer, the reporters soon stopped and gasped for air.

"That's strange. There are actually still selfless people out there that does something good like this without leaving their names behind just like Lei Feng……"[2]

[2] Lei Feng [雷锋] – Léi Fēng (18 December 1940  - 15 August 1962) was a soldier of the Chinese army in Communist legend. After his death, Lei was characterized as a selfless and modest person devoted to the Communist Party, Mao Zedong, and the people of China. In 1963, he became the subject of a nationwide posthumous propaganda campaign, “Follow the examples of Comrade Lei Feng.” Lei was portrayed as a model citizen, and the masses were encouraged to emulate his selflessness, modesty, and devotion to Mao. After Mao’s death, Lei Feng remained a cultural icon representing earnestness and service. His name entered daily speech and his imagery appeared on T-shirts and memorabilia.
